MIRANDA GOMEZ, Osvaldo y NAPOLES PEREZ, Mailyn. History ant theories of appearance of human immunodeficiency virus. Rev Cub Med Mil [online]. 2009, vol.38, n.3-4, pp. 0-0. ISSN 1561-3046.
Pandemic of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) is a worldwide problem. From its appearance at the end of XX century has been related to some conflicts on its origin and discovering. The aim of this review is to give detailed information on HIV origin and its syndrome, thus, we made a data gathering on backgrounds and emergence theories. Despite that Cuba shows one of the lowest rate of this disease in Latin America, case incidence in Cuban population is annually increasing. We must to be present that the community diseases has incidence on our troops since Army is the uniformed population.
